Karamitsos Winery
Intro
Karamitsos Winery is located at the entrance of Nemea, directly opposite the historic monastery of Panagia tou Vrachou. The Karamitsos family has been involved in the region's viticulture for approximately 70 years.
Estate
The first small winery began operations in 2002, while the new, modern winery started its activities in 2016.
Vineyards
All wines are produced exclusively from privately owned vineyards. The range of wines includes: Poseidon – Dry white from Assyrtiko, Aphrodite – Rosé from Agiorgitiko, Two Lions White / Red – Blends inspired by the Nemean Lion, Sporos, Riza, Tree of Life, Spirit of Pink, Niki. Total production: ~200,000 liters annually. Bottling: 40% of production. Aging: Underground cellar with French oak barrels.
